博客园  :: 首页  :: 新随笔  :: 联系 :: 订阅 订阅  :: 管理

设计模式学习小结——设计原则之外的一些东西

Posted on 2009-11-28 21:03  都市牧羊  阅读(585)  评论(0编辑  收藏  举报

 

  记得《阿甘正传》里的主人公阿甘经常对别人说:“小时候,妈妈经常告诉我。。。”。其实,妈妈教孩子的都是最基础、最简单的道理。而等孩子长大之后大都把这些道理遗忘或不以为然了,只有阿甘这个“傻乎乎”的家伙经常把这些道理拿出来教导自己。于是他在越南战场上全身而退(当然屁股挨了一枪),回国后捕虾成了富翁,还投资了一家‘卖苹果的电脑公司’,后来又参加了乒乓外交。可见,那些简单的、基础的道理是很重要的。

  扯远了,言归正传。学习一段时间的设计模式后,我也总结出2条自认为很简单、甚至很傻的心得:

  1、一般,模式名称对应的类为模式的核心类,用户用的就是该类。

  2、要把用户也考虑进去。

      就我个人而言总觉得抓不住模式的要害,后来才发现忽略了这些最简单的东西。

      我写的都是自己的一点心得,请大家不要拍我板砖:)